The software uses sophisticated algorithms to bypass the operating system's normal file management. When you delete a file normally, Windows typically just removes the pointer to that file—the actual data often remains on the drive until overwritten. iCare scans the raw sectors of your drive to find these "orphaned" files and reassemble them.

Many professional data recovery brands offer free editions of their software. For example, the official free version of iCare Data Recovery allows you to restore a limited amount of data completely free of charge. This lets you test if your files are recoverable before spending any money. Open-Source and Free Programs
